This is a story about John Millen's spiritual awakening. The tale begins with his powerful teenage vision to build an innovative 35-foot trimaran sailboat and take up his life on the high seas and the wild beaches of the world. During his two-year sailing adventure, he discovered resources and sensibilities deep within himself that allowed him to begin to see his life in a different way.

After returning home, his story turns inward toward the mysteries of the mind, where he meets his Daimon, a spirit from a higher vibration, who teaches him how to live from his soul and introduces him to the world of universal consciousness.

In the last part of the book, Millen sets before the reader a selection of his journeys into alternate realities that follow his initiation into shamanic consciousness and tell of ecstatic experiences of the Divine.
